Ternat (Dutch pronunciation: [tɛrˈnɑt]; also French: Ternath) is a municipality located in the Belgian province of Flemish Brabant.
The municipality comprises the villages of Sint-Katherina-Lombeek, Ternat proper and Wambeek.
The village of Ternat is the site of a medieval sandstone church and the 12th-century Kruikenburg Castle, extensively remodelled in the 17th century.
[2] The local authority offices are housed in an 18th-century mansion.
